The invention provides a vehicle energy-saving method and device based on road condition fusion, and the method comprises the steps: obtaining the environment information of a vehicle, and the environment information comprises the current road condition information, the traffic light information and the vehicle position information; based on the traffic signal lamp information and the vehicle position information, determining a driving distance from the vehicle to a traffic signal lamp intersection; based on the driving distance, the current road condition information and the traffic signal lamp information, calculating an allowable vehicle speed range of an intersection without waiting for passing through the traffic signal lamp; determining an output efficiency interval of a motor of the vehicle based on the allowable vehicle speed range; based on the output efficiency interval, the optimal vehicle speed of the vehicle is determined; and controlling the vehicle to run at the optimal vehicle speed according to the optimal vehicle speed. Therefore, the vehicle is prevented from waiting at the intersection of the traffic signal lamp, namely the vehicle is prevented from starting after parking, and the purpose of saving the energy consumption of the vehicle is achieved.
